[][src]Struct graph_rs_types::entitytypes::PlannerTask

pub struct PlannerTask {
    pub created_by: IdentitySet,
    pub plan_id: String,
    pub bucket_id: String,
    pub title: String,
    pub order_hint: String,
    pub assignee_priority: String,
    pub percent_complete: i32,
    pub start_date_time: String,
    pub created_date_time: String,
    pub due_date_time: String,
    pub has_description: bool,
    pub preview_type: PlannerPreviewType,
    pub completed_date_time: String,
    pub completed_by: IdentitySet,
    pub reference_count: i32,
    pub checklist_item_count: i32,
    pub active_checklist_item_count: i32,
    pub applied_categories: PlannerAppliedCategories,
    pub assignments: PlannerAssignments,
    pub conversation_thread_id: String,
    pub details: PlannerTaskDetails,
    pub assigned_to_task_board_format: PlannerAssignedToTaskBoardTaskFormat,
    pub progress_task_board_format: PlannerProgressTaskBoardTaskFormat,
    pub bucket_task_board_format: PlannerBucketTaskBoardTaskFormat,
}

Fields

created_by: IdentitySetplan_id: Stringbucket_id: Stringtitle: Stringorder_hint: Stringassignee_priority: Stringpercent_complete: i32start_date_time: Stringcreated_date_time: Stringdue_date_time: Stringhas_description: boolpreview_type: PlannerPreviewTypecompleted_date_time: Stringcompleted_by: IdentitySetreference_count: i32checklist_item_count: i32active_checklist_item_count: i32applied_categories: PlannerAppliedCategoriesassignments: PlannerAssignmentsconversation_thread_id: Stringdetails: PlannerTaskDetailsassigned_to_task_board_format: PlannerAssignedToTaskBoardTaskFormatprogress_task_board_format: PlannerProgressTaskBoardTaskFormatbucket_task_board_format: PlannerBucketTaskBoardTaskFormat

Trait Implementations

impl Eq for PlannerTask[src]

impl Clone for PlannerTask[src]

impl PartialEq<PlannerTask> for PlannerTask[src]

impl Debug for PlannerTask[src]

impl Serialize for PlannerTask[src]

impl<'de> Deserialize<'de> for PlannerTask[src]

Auto Trait Implementations

Blanket Implementations

impl<T> ToOwned for T where
    T: Clone
[src]

type Owned = T

The resulting type after obtaining ownership.

impl<T, U> Into<U> for T where
    U: From<T>, 
[src]

impl<T> From<T> for T[src]

impl<T, U> TryFrom<U> for T where
    U: Into<T>, 
[src]

type Error = Infallible

The type returned in the event of a conversion error.

impl<T, U> TryInto<U> for T where
    U: TryFrom<T>, 
[src]

type Error = <U as TryFrom<T>>::Error

The type returned in the event of a conversion error.

impl<T> BorrowMut<T> for T where
    T: ?Sized
[src]

impl<T> Borrow<T> for T where
    T: ?Sized
[src]

impl<T> Any for T where
    T: 'static + ?Sized
[src]

impl<T> DeserializeOwned for T where
    T: Deserialize<'de>, 
[src]